?
服務(wù)器的服務(wù)root賬號擁有最高權限,允許用戶(hù)執行所??(′?_?`)有(╯°□°)╯操作,服務(wù)包括安裝軟件、服務(wù)修改系統設置和管理其他用戶(hù)賬戶(hù)。服務(wù)
服務(wù)器( ?ヮ?)root登(╬ ò﹏ó)錄問(wèn)題是服務(wù)系統管理員經(jīng)常遇到的一個(gè)常見(jiàn)問(wèn)題,通常,服務(wù)無(wú)法登錄為root用戶(hù)可能是服務(wù)由于多種原因造成的,包括密碼問(wèn)題、服務(wù)SSH配置錯誤、服務(wù)網(wǎng)絡(luò )問(wèn)題或安全設置等,服務(wù)以下是服務(wù)一些(???)詳細的技術(shù)介紹和解決方法:
檢查root密碼
確保您知(zhi)道正確的root密碼,并且嘗試使用其他終端或設備登錄以排除硬件故障的服務(wù)可能性,如果您忘記了root密碼,服務(wù)可以通過(guò)以下步驟重??置:
1、服務(wù)重啟服務(wù)器并進(jìn)入引導加載器(如GRUヾ(?■_■)ノB)。服務(wù)
2、選擇要啟動(dòng)的內核版本ヽ(′▽?zhuān)?ノ并按“e”鍵編輯。
3、在編輯模式下,找到以“l(fā)inux”或“l(fā)inux16”開(kāi)(kai)頭的行。
4??、在該行的末尾添加“init=/bin/bash”,然后按Ctrl+X啟動(dòng)。
5、系統將啟動(dòng)至單用戶(hù)模式,您可以輸入passwd root來(lái)更??改root密碼。
檢查SSH配置??
如果root用戶(hù)通過(guò)SSH登錄失敗,請檢查/etc/ssh/sshd_config配置文件中的設置,確(que)保以下參數沒(méi)有被錯誤配置:
PermitRootLogin 確保設置為yes以允許root登錄。
Passworヽ(′ー`)ノdAuthenticatioヾ(′?`)?n 確保設置為yes以允許密碼認證。
修改配置文件后,需要重啟SSH服務(wù)以應(ying)用更改:
sudo systemctl?? restart ssh檢查防火墻設置
有時(shí),防火墻可能會(huì )阻止root用戶(hù)的登錄嘗試,檢查服務(wù)器上的防火墻規則,確保SSH端口(默認為22)是開(kāi)放的,并且沒(méi)有特定的規則阻止root登錄。
檢查網(wǎng)絡(luò )問(wèn)題
網(wǎng)絡(luò )連接問(wèn)??題也可能導致登錄失敗,確保服務(wù)器的網(wǎng)絡(luò )連接是穩定的,并且??沒(méi)有任何中間設備(如路由器或防火墻)阻止了訪(fǎng)問(wèn)。
考慮安全因素
出于安全考慮,某些系統可能禁用了root直接登錄,在這種情況??下,可以使用具有sudo權限的非root用戶(hù)登錄(╯‵□′)╯,然后執行sudo su命令(′?_?`)切換到root用戶(hù)。
日志文件分析
當登錄問(wèn)題發(fā)生時(shí),查看┐(′?`)┌相關(guān)的日志文件可以提供寶貴的線(xiàn)索,對于SSH登錄,ヽ(′▽?zhuān)?ノ應檢查/var/log/auヽ(′ー`)ノth.loヽ(′ー`)ノg或/var/log/secure文件中的錯誤消息。
使用救援模式
如果上述方法都無(wú)法解決問(wèn)題,可以考慮使用救援模式(rescue mode)來(lái)修復系統,這通常涉及到從安裝介質(zhì)啟(′?ω?`)動(dòng)并進(jìn)入一個(gè)最小化的系統環(huán)境,以便進(jìn)行修復操作。
相關(guān)問(wèn)題與解答
Q1: 如果忘記了root密碼,但無(wú)法通過(guò)引導加載器進(jìn)入單用戶(hù)模式,該怎么辦?
A1: 可以嘗試使用其他救援工具,如systemd的rescue shell或者從其他可信任的系統通過(guò)(?Д?)網(wǎng)絡(luò )啟動(dòng)一個(gè)救援shell。
Q2: 為什么修改了SSH配置文件后還需要重啟SSH服務(wù)?
A2: SSH服務(wù)在啟動(dòng)時(shí)會(huì )讀取配置文件,并在內存中保持配置狀態(tài),修改配置文件后,必須重啟服務(wù)才能使更改生效。
A3: 最佳實(shí)踐是不禁用root登錄,而是創(chuàng )建一個(gè)具有sudo權限的用戶(hù)賬戶(hù),這樣可以減少對root賬戶(hù)的依賴(lài),并提高系( ?ヮ?)統的安全性。
Q4: 如果我無(wú)法訪(fǎng)問(wèn)服務(wù)器的物理控(′▽?zhuān)?制(zhi)臺,還有其他方法(′?_?`)可以恢復對服務(wù)器的訪(fǎng)問(wèn)嗎?
A4: 如果是云服務(wù)器或虛擬化環(huán)境,通??梢酝ㄟ^(guò)管理控制臺訪(fǎng)問(wèn)救援模式或使用供應商提供的其他(′?_?`)恢復工(╥_╥)具,如果是托管服務(wù)器,可能需要聯(lián)系服務(wù)提供商尋求幫助。